About this course

Throughout the course, learners acquire essential skills in designing, implementing, and managing pollinator-friendly urban habitats. They study the science behind pollination, the importance of pollinators in urban ecosystems, and the best practices for creating sustainable green spaces that benefit both pollinators and communities. By earning this certificate, learners demonstrate their commitment to environmental stewardship and showcase their expertise in designing urban spaces that support pollinators. This knowledge equips them for career advancement in landscape architecture, urban planning, and related fields, making a positive impact on the environment and the communities they serve.

Course Details

• Introduction to Pollinators & Urban Spaces
• Understanding the Importance of Pollinators in Urban Areas
• Design Principles for Pollinator-Friendly Urban Spaces
• Plant Selection for Urban Pollinator Gardens
• Creating Habitats for Native Bees in Cities
• Designing Urban Rooftops & Walls for Pollinators
• Implementing Sustainable Practices for Pollinators in Urban Landscapes
• Monitoring & Evaluating Pollinator Biodiversity in Urban Spaces
• Public Engagement & Advocacy for Pollinators in Urban Planning
• Case Studies: Successful Pollinator Design Projects in Urban Areas
